WebMar 14, 2024 · Snapping scapula syndrome (SSS) is a disruption of the normal smooth motion of the scapulothoracic joint leading to clicking or “snapping” which can be painful or painless. There are a variety of etiologies with first-line treatment being conservative. If patients fail extensive nonoperative treatments, then surgery may be considered.

WebScapulothoracic Dissociation is a high-energy traumatic disruption of the scapulothoracic articulation often associated with severe neurovascular injuries, scapula fractures, and clavicular fractures.
